		<description><![CDATA[Roku plans to embed its streaming media player technology into a thumbdrive-style device that plugs directly into a TV&#8217;s HDMI port. The &#8220;Roku Streaming Stick&#8221; will instantly convert ordinary TVs into &#8220;smart TVs,&#8221; says Roku CEO Anthony Wood. 		<description><![CDATA[Boxee released version 1.5 of its free multimedia streaming software for Mac, Windows, and Linux desktops today, but simultaneously announced that it will cease offering the Boxee desktop software after January 2012.
